Martin Reeves

Director, BCG Henderson Institute, Senior Partner and Managing Director, BCG
ABOUT

Martin Reeves is a Senior Partner and Managing Director in the New York office of The Boston Consulting Group and Global Director of the BCG Henderson Institute, BCG's think tank on business strategy. Current research themes include growth and resilience, strategy and artificial intelligence, diversity and performance, global digital hegemony, digital emergence, new bases of competitive advantage, corporate longevity, the lost art of CEO reflection, the humanity of corporations, and economic complexity. Martin is also author of a recent book on strategy, Your Strategy Needs a Strategy (HBR Press), which deals with choosing and executing the right approach in today's complex and dynamic business environment. Martin holds a triple first class MA in natural sciences from Cambridge University and an MBA from Cranfield School of Management. He also studied Japanese at Osaka University of Foreign Studies and biophysics at the University of Tokyo.
